New Jersey A1632 requires school districts to allow home-schooled students to join extracurricular activities in their resident district.

New Jersey A1632 mandates that school districts permit home-schooled students to participate in school-sponsored extracurricular activities, including clubs, musical ensembles, interscholastic sports, and theatrical productions, in their resident district. The bill requires districts to offer physical examinations or medical tests to home-schooled students if these are conditions for participation.
